合约地址上的代币能否取出?从技术、市场到治理的全面解析

引言:当代币被发送到合约地址(token contract 或任意智能合约)时,持币者常会担心是否可取回。本篇面向开发者与普通用户,综合技术可行性、风险控制与宏观市场影响,讨论取回策略与相关经济、技术与治理要点。

1) 理解“合约地址上的币”几种情形

- 发送到普通外部账户(EOA):可用该账户私钥在Trust Wallet等恢复并转出。

- 发送到智能合约地址(非拥有私钥):是否可转出取决于合约代码是否提供转出/救援接口(rescue, withdraw, reclaim)。

- 发送到代币合约自身地址或不可调用的合约:通常不可逆,因合约没有转出逻辑或已锁死。

2) 技术路径与可行性(谨慎操作)

- 首先查阅合约源代码与ABI(Etherscan/BscScan):搜索是否存在 owner-only 的救援方法、可燃烧/可铸造函数或管理员权限。

- 若合约提供救援接口:可由合约拥有者或多签调用。普通用户应联系项目方或合约管理员请求执行,并要求透明记录交互tx哈希。

- 若无救援接口且合约可升级(proxy 模式):如果管理员可升级合约,理论上可升级后添加转出逻辑。但这取决于治理与权限。

- 若为不可变合约或代币合约自身:通常无法恢复,属链上不可逆损失。

- 使用工具:用安全的Web3钱包(优先硬件或受信钱包),通过Etherscan的“Write Contract”或Metamask + Remix/Hardhat 与合约交互。请先在测试网验证并仅在确认产权与合约可信时执行写操作。

3) Trust Wallet 角色与限制

- Trust Wallet 可管理私钥、显示代币、通过DApp/WalletConnect 与合约交互,但其内置功能对复杂合约交互有限。通常推荐使用带开发者交互能力的钱包(如 Metamask)并将签名硬件化。

4) 风险与合规建议

- 切勿向陌生方支付“代币取回费”或私钥。回收操作必须由合约权限持有者执行。

- 建议保存所有沟通记录、tx哈希,必要时向区块链社区或交易所说明情况,防止诈骗。

5) 代币审计与预防措施

- 代币应经过第三方审计(Slither, MythX, CertiK 等),重点检查救援函数、权限管理、是否有 timelock、多签设置与可升级性风险。

- 发布前在白皮书中明确“误转机制”和紧急治理流程,设置回收冷门方案或自动回退机制(如果业务允许)。

6) 硬分叉、治理与链上事件的影响

- 硬分叉可在极端情况下改变链上状态(如历史交易回滚),但现实中极为罕见且伴随重大争议与风险,不应作为常规取回手段。

- 社区治理可通过提案、投票改变合约管理权(例如启用升级器或授权救援),但需多数共识。

7) 实时行情分析与市场动向预测

- 误转与取回事件会影响项目声誉与流动性,短期内可能触发抛售或流动性移除。监测实时指标:DEX 流动性深度、池子TVL、持币地址数与链上转账行为。

- 预测要点:若救援成功且透明,市场信心有望恢复;若不可回收,长期影响取决于代币供给减少/锁死比例和项目原有基本面。

8) 未来经济特征与新兴科技革命的相关性

- 代币经济将更强调可恢复性、可审计性与治理韧性。新兴技术(zk-rollups、账户抽象、可组合合约、安全模块化)将降低误转风险并增强合约可控性。

- 跨链桥与自动化保险、智能合约钱包(带救援社群/时间锁)将成为主流防护手段。

结论:能否取回合约地址上的代币,核心取决于合约设计与权限管理。用户应先做链上尽职调查,优先通过合约管理员或项目方在透明环境下执行救援;若合约不可恢复,则应评估项目的长期经济影响并从治理、审计与技术上推进预防策略。始终以安全第一、审计与多签治理为基石。

作者:林若辰发布时间:2025-12-03 15:39:01

评论

Alex_链工

非常全面,特别赞同把救援权限和可升级性纳入审计重点。

小白学币

我之前不小心转到合约,现在明白了应该先看源码再联系项目方。

CryptoCat

关于硬分叉部分解释得很清楚,确实不是常规手段,风险太大。

李安全

建议补充常见工具的操作示例(测试网验证流程),但总体很实用。

相关阅读